package org.eclipse.papyrus.cpp.codegen.jet.util;
import org.eclipse.uml2.uml.*;
import org.eclipse.uml2.uml.Class;
import Cpp.*;
import org.eclipse.papyrus.cpp.codegen.utils.*;
public class CppOperationReturnType
{
protected static String nl;
public static synchronized CppOperationReturnType create(String lineSeparator)
{
nl = lineSeparator;
CppOperationReturnType result = new CppOperationReturnType();
nl = null;
return result;
}
public final String NL = nl == null ? (System.getProperties().getProperty("line.separator")) : nl;
protected final String TEXT_1 = "::";
public String generate(Object argument)
{
final StringBuffer stringBuffer = new StringBuffer();
//////////////////////////////////////////////////////////////////////////////////////////
// Java preparation
//////////////////////////////////////////////////////////////////////////////////////////
// Retrieve the Operation
Operation currentOperation = (Operation) argument;
String returnTypeName = "void";
String ownerName = "";
Modifier modifier = new Modifier();
// Return type
if (currentOperation.getType() == null) {
returnTypeName = "void";
} else {
if (currentOperation.getType() == null) {
returnTypeName = "undefined";
} else {
// Treat the type if it is not "package visibility" and owned by a class
Type currentType = currentOperation.getType();
returnTypeName = GenUtils.qualifiedName (currentType);
if (currentType.getVisibility() != VisibilityKind.PACKAGE_LITERAL) {
if (currentType.getOwner() instanceof Class) {
ownerName = ((Class) currentType.getOwner()).getName();
}
}
}
// Treat pointer or ref on return parameter (only one return parameter should exists)
// retrieve return parameter
// RS: changed test: now getReturnResult returns only one param
// if (currentOperation.getUml2Operation().getReturnResults().size() == 1) {
// org.eclipse.uml2.uml.Parameter uml2Param
// = (org.eclipse.uml2.uml.Parameter) currentOperation.getUml2Operation().getReturnResults().get(0);
// Parameter currentRParameter
// = new Parameter(uml2Param);
// // case Pointer
// if (currentRParameter.hasStereotype(xy, CppPtr.class)) {
// isPointer = " "+currentRParameter.getTaggedValue(CppPtr.class, "declaration");
// }
// if (currentRParameter.hasStereotype(xy, CppRef.class)) {
// isRef = " "+currentRParameter.getTaggedValue(CppRef.class, "declaration");
// }
// if (currentRParameter.hasStereotype(xy, CppConst.class_)) {
// isConst = "const ";
// }
// }
if (currentOperation.getReturnResult() instanceof Parameter) {
Parameter uml2Param = (Parameter) currentOperation.getReturnResult();
modifier = new Modifier(uml2Param);
}
}
//////////////////////////////////////////////////////////////////////////////////////////
// The following part contains the template two cases : scope required or not
//////////////////////////////////////////////////////////////////////////////////////////
// No scope details
if (ownerName.equals("")) {
//////////////////////////////////////////////////////////////////////////////////////////
stringBuffer.append( modifier.isConst );
stringBuffer.append( returnTypeName );
stringBuffer.append( modifier.ptr );
stringBuffer.append( modifier.ref );
//////////////////////////////////////////////////////////////////////////////////////////
} else {
//////////////////////////////////////////////////////////////////////////////////////////
stringBuffer.append( modifier.isConst );
stringBuffer.append( ownerName );
stringBuffer.append(TEXT_1);
stringBuffer.append( returnTypeName );
stringBuffer.append( modifier.ptr );
stringBuffer.append( modifier.ref );
//////////////////////////////////////////////////////////////////////////////////////////
}
//////////////////////////////////////////////////////////////////////////////////////////
return stringBuffer.toString();
}
}
